Choke PointsIn the Event of a Water Landing tells for the first time the full stories of the Bermuda Sky Queen and Sovereign of the Skies rescues, the only two completely successful open water ditchings in Commercial Aviation history. Using the voices of the passengers, flight crew, and the Cutter’s crewmen an amazing tale unfolds. Their vivid memories, interspersed with contemporary news reports, flesh out the unemotional entries from the cutter’s logbook and official investigations. Bloodstained Sea - The U.S. Coast Guard in the Battle of the Atlantic, 1941-1944, is about the Coast Guard's role in guarding the convoys of merchant ships carrying vital materiel to our allies during WWII. It tells the powerful and inspiring story of the men of the U.S. Coast Guard, who—normally dedicated to saving lives and rescuing ships in distress—were locked in one of the longest and bloodiest running sea battles in history.
